    This is my in-progress scratch build of a Hunley hull section. Base kit is the Military Miniatures Warehouse Lt. Dixon w/ partial hull. The base kit hull is just not well formed, so I set about making one. It is a balsa core with sheet styrene glued over it. I have added about 400 grant line rivets. About ready for paint. The other kits are the Verlinden 54mm full-hull and half-hull. I also have a 54mm figure of General PT Beuregard to add. It will all be one big display with the half-hull in "water" the full hull in "dry-dock" and the 120mm vingette as well.
